Synopsis

This self growth focused motivational book teaches you how to find yourself.

Target harmful patterns. Surrounded by the pressures of society, we often measure ourselves by impossible standards, causing us to doubt ourselves. When this causes negative self-talk, our happiness inevitably suffers. Unhealthy mindsets can also infiltrate our relationships with others. Women can feel the need to be caretakers and sometimes put others' needs above our own. By identifying these patterns, we can set boundaries and target areas that need change—so you can love yourself properly.

Become a loving friend to yourself. While all of us certainly have a calling to love others, it is just as important to give that same love to yourself. It feels good to be yourself, but you must find yourself first. In this emotional strength book, Patton shares impactful stories to show readers how to journey from a place of fear to a life of courageous self-acceptance and real love.

Inside you'll find: how to find and be yourself through the pressures of today; stories of growth and healing from Patton and other women; and how to set boundaries, communicate more effectively, and change self-deprecating behaviors.

About Sue Patton Thoele

Sue Patton Thoele is a licensed psychotherapist and the author of The Woman's Book of Confidence, The Woman's Book of Courage, and The Woman's Book of Spirit among other books. She and her husband, Gene, live in Boulder, Colorado.
